Single-Family Homes: Prices & Sales Are Up! 🏡📈
The Oahu single-family home market remains strong, with prices and sales increasing year-over-year.
📊 Key Stats for January 2025:
✔ Number of Sales: Up 6.5% (196 homes sold) compared to 184 sales in January 2024.
✔ Median Home Price: Up 9.7% from $1,021,016 to $1,120,000.
✔ Days on Market: Homes are selling faster, dropping from 29 days to 25 days (a 13.8% decrease).
✔ Inventory: More homes are available, with a 20.9% increase in active listings (607 homes last year vs. 734 homes today).
What This Means for Buyers & Sellers
📌 For Buyers: More inventory means more choices! However, prices are rising, so waiting too long could mean paying more.
📌 For Sellers: Homes are selling quickly and at higher prices—but with more inventory hitting the market, competition is growing.
Oahu Condo Market: More Inventory, Longer Sales Times 🏙️
The Oahu condo market is following a similar trend, with sales and prices increasing—but condos are taking longer to sell.
📊 Key Condo Stats for January 2025:
✔ Number of Sales: Up 6.8% (312 condos sold) compared to 292 sales in January 2024.
✔ Median Condo Price: Up 7.4% from $502,500 to $539,500.
✔ Days on Market: Condos are taking longer to sell, increasing 34.5% (from 29 days to 39 days).
✔ Inventory Surge: Condo listings increased by 54.9% (1,348 condos last year vs. 2,098 condos today).
What This Means for Buyers & Sellers
📌 For Buyers: More inventory means more choices and better negotiating power! Now could be a great time to buy.
📌 For Sellers: With so many condos on the market, standing out is crucial. Pricing your unit correctly and having a strong marketing strategy will be key.
